A software application designed for the Android operating system facilitates the retrieval and presentation of detailed hardware and software specifications of the device it is installed on. This category of applications commonly provides information such as the device model, processor type, memory capacity, operating system version, and sensor data. For example, a user can employ such an application to confirm the amount of available RAM or to verify the Android operating system build number.
The importance of these applications lies in their ability to provide transparency into the inner workings of an Android device. This is beneficial for troubleshooting performance issues, confirming compatibility with specific software or hardware, and understanding the device’s capabilities. Historically, this type of information was only accessible through technical menus or developer tools. These applications make this data readily available to the average user.
